12th April 2011, 06:10 PM #14
I'm using Outlook 2007, so the path may be different in your version. However, I think you need to look at your 'stationary' settings. In my version the path is Tools-> Options-> Mail Format-> Stationary and Fonts.
Once you are there, check the 3 Font settings.Chris
